About Shelley Winters

Shelley Winters was born on 18 August 1920 in St. Louis, Missouri, USA. Shelley Winters passed away on 14 January 2006 at the age of 85. Winner of Oscar. We have 10 films with Shelley Winters available. Among Shelley Winters's most popular films: Lolita, The Night of the Hunter, The Poseidon Adventure, Alfie, Harper.

Shelley Winters was an American actress born on August 18, 1920, in St. Louis, Missouri. She became known for her versatile performances in both film and television, earning acclaim for her work across various genres. Winters gained significant recognition for her roles in notable films such as "Lolita," directed by Stanley Kubrick, and "The Night of the Hunter," a classic thriller directed by Charles Laughton. Her performance in these films solidified her reputation as a talented and dynamic actress.

In the 1970s, Winters starred in the disaster film "The Poseidon Adventure," which further showcased her acting range and contributed to her enduring legacy in Hollywood. Over her career, she received numerous accolades and established herself as a prominent figure in the entertainment industry. Shelley Winters passed away on January 14, 2006.
